first ill explain my query to avoid misunderstanding. i set a query to get weekly results for this report im working on. the query does this by
Between Date() And Date()-7
now i need to know how to get the date range to show in my report. i have a box that has start date and end date but i dont know how to get those dates in my report under those headings. got any advice? another thing to take in to consideration is the fact that not every day of the week has an entry, so i need to get my dates from the range of the query. say the first entry is on tuesday then my start date needs the date of the first record of the week being tuesday....

not sure if thats clear on what im doing but i hope to get some help here...
thanks in advance..
 
Pass the criteria dates to the report in the OpenArgs argument of the OpenReport command.
